### Pagination

All list endpoints in the Corvane public REST API return results in pages governed by an opaque, signed cursor. Cursors embed no customer data and expire after 24 hours, limiting replay exposure. Clients supply `limit` (max 100) and `cursor` parameters; tampered cursors return a 400 rather than leaking partial results. Reviewers auditing cursor signing should exercise the internal verification endpoint, which sits behind service authentication. That endpoint accepts the internal key appended below.

service key, kageg-yagep: zpat11_eqeO8gygq4O

Before cutting a release, verify the sidecar version matrix in `COMPAT.md`; mismatched aggregation windows between the sidecar and the collector are the most common source of release-blocking alerts. Known issues and workarounds are tracked in the public issue board, and each release candidate gets a smoke-test report within one business day. If a blocker surfaces during a release window, or you need an expedited compatibility review, email the team directly.

escalation mailbox, bafog-fafog: ulador@paliqlabs.internal

Finance Review Summary — Velmora Expansion

Branch managers should note that Korrin Foods' entry into the Velmora coastal region remains within budget, though leasing costs ran 6% above forecast. Staffing ramp-up is on schedule, and early revenue from the Port Ashlen branch exceeds projections. Capital reserves remain adequate for phase two. The confidential outlook for next year follows below.

board note of kageg-bahof: The renewal with Holwynax Holdings closes at $2 million a year, 5 percent below the last contract. Project Ulaath slips by two quarters because of the supplier delay.